peratioalization of Ehtesab Commission in KP
Posted about 1 year ago | Onepakistannews
Peshawar : The Chief Minister Khyber PakhtunkhwaPervez Khattak has directed the government officials to immediately
operationalize the provision of Ehtesab Act in letter and spirit.
Meanwhile the Speaker Provincial Assembly has officially been approached to constitutethelegislative committee on
governance and accountability, It was officially revealed here today. Accordingly it said theprovincial government has also
initiated steps for establishing Ehtesab Courts which would be independent and autonomous in all respect and nobody would dare
influencing it.
The government is also mulling thename of persons of high integrity to be nominated to thefirst search and scrutiny committee.
Office building is being located for housing the Estesab Commission to ensure smooth start. Establishmnet of Ehtesab
Commission is a solid step towards good governance, transparency, meritocracy and prosperity.

Hamid appointed DG Ehtesab Commission KP
Pledges to carry out across-the-boardaccountability

PESHAWAR: Lt-General (r) Hamid Khan, the newly appointed director general of the
Ehtesab Commission,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, has said that he would discharge his duty
without fear and favour to make accountable those involved in corruption and misuse of
powers.
When approached by The News on Wednesday soon after the notification of his appointment as the
head of the recently created provincial Ehtesab Commission was issued, he said the search committee
appointed by the government had approached him and offered him the job. “Mine isn’t a political
appointment. I am a non-political person and am taking up this appointment in the larger public
interest,” he pointed out. He added that he would ensure that the Ehtesab Commission carried out
across-the-board accountability.
Lt-Gen (r) Hamid Khan served as Corps Commander Peshawar from 2005-2007 and led the military
operations against the militants in the Federally Administered Tribal Areas (Fata) and Khyber
Pakhtunkhwa. Earlier in his military career, he had served as general officer commanding, Kohat. He
also remained the president of the National Defence University, Islamabad.
He didn’t take up any formal job after retirement from the Pakistan Army in 2009 and preferred living
on his farmhouse in Charsadda district looking after his agricultural fields. He also supervised the
working of a school being run by his family for the under-privileged students of the area.
Some months ago, he was made the head of the Pakistan Red Crescent Society, Khyber Pakhtunkhwa
chapter, in an honorary capacity. He began taking keen interest in this job to look after the needs of
the internally displaced persons and other needy people.
The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I)-led Khyber Pakhtunkhwa government had promised to set up an
independent Ehtesab Commission in the province as it had accused the federal government of being
selective in carrying out accountability. Chief Minister Pervez Khattak had said on numerous occasions
that their Ehtesab Commission would be so powerful that it could even make him accountable.
The provincial government had set up a search committee to propose the names of credible people to
become members of the Ehtesab Commission and also for the office of its director general. Among
others, the search committee had former Inspector General of Police Mohammad Abbas Khan, former
chief secretary Ejaz Qureshi and former Peshawar High Court judge Sher Mohammad Khan as
members.
The search committee recommended appointment of former Peshawar High Court judge Hamid Farooq
Durrani as head of the Ehtesab Commission and four others as its members. They are supposed to
make policies of the Ehtesab Commission while the task of the day-to-day running of the commission
would be handled by its director general, Lt-Gen (r) Hamid Khan.
